В современном цифровом мире базы данных играют важную роль в управлении информацией. Независимо от того, создаете ли вы простой веб-сайт или сложное веб-приложение, вам потребуется надежный инструмент для управления базой данных. PHPMyAdmin является одним из таких инструментов, который широко используется благодаря легкости использования и обширному набору функций. В сочетании с XAMPP он становится мощным решением для управления базами данных в локальной серверной среде. В этом руководстве мы узнаем, как эффективно использовать PHPMyAdmin в XAMPP для управления базами данных.
Что такое XAMPP?
XAMPP — это бесплатный и открытый кросс-платформенный пакет решений для веб-серверов, разработанный Apache Friends. Он предоставляет простую в установке дистрибуцию, содержащую сервер Apache HTTP, MariaDB (бывший MySQL) и интерпретаторы для скриптов, написанных на языках программирования PHP и Perl. XAMPP — отличный инструмент для разработчиков, чтобы создавать, развивать и тестировать приложения локально перед их развертыванием на живом сервере.
Что такое PHPMyAdmin?
PHPMyAdmin — это бесплатный и открытый инструмент, написанный на PHP, предназначенный для управления MariaDB и MySQL через веб-интерфейс. Он популярен благодаря веб-интерфейсу, который позволяет пользователям выполнять различные задачи по управлению базами данных, такие как создание и изменение баз данных, таблиц, полей и индексов. Он также способен выполнять SQL-запросы и эффективно управлять пользователями и разрешениями.
Установка XAMPP
Прежде чем использовать PHPMyAdmin, необходимо установить XAMPP на свой локальный компьютер. Процесс простой:
Скачайте установщик XAMPP с веб-сайта Apache Friends. Выберите версию, совместимую с вашей операционной системой.
Запустите установщик и следуйте инструкциям по установке. Убедитесь, что компоненты Apache и MySQL выбраны во время процесса установки.
После установки запустите панель управления XAMPP. Эта панель позволяет запускать и останавливать различные компоненты, включенные в XAMPP, такие как Apache и MySQL.
Доступ к PHPMyAdmin
После установки XAMPP на вашем компьютере доступ к PHPMyAdmin осуществляется легко. Следуйте этим шагам, чтобы открыть PHPMyAdmin:
Откройте панель управления XAMPP. Вы должны увидеть список сервисов, таких как Apache, MySQL и другие. Нажмите кнопку «Start» рядом с Apache и MySQL, чтобы запустить эти службы.
После запуска обеих служб откройте веб-браузер и введите http://localhost/phpmyadmin в адресной строке и нажмите «Enter».
Вы увидите интерфейс PHPMyAdmin, где вы можете управлять своими базами данных.
Интерфейс PHPMyAdmin
После открытия PHPMyAdmin на странице по умолчанию отобразится панель навигации слева и рабочая область справа. Давайте исследуем основные секции:
Панель навигации: Этот раздел отображает список всех баз данных на вашем сервере. Вы можете нажать на любую базу данных, чтобы развернуть её и просмотреть её таблицы.
Рабочая область: Эта область показывает различные вкладки, такие как Database, SQL, Status, Users, Export, Import и т.д. Каждая вкладка предоставляет уникальную функциональность.
Создание базы данных
Для выполнения операций с базами данных сначала необходимо создать базу данных. Вот как это сделать:
В интерфейсе PHPMyAdmin нажмите вкладку «Databases» в рабочей области.
Вы увидите поле с надписью «Create Database». Введите имя для новой базы данных.
Выберите сопоставление из выпадающего списка - если нет особых требований, обычно подходит значение по умолчанию.
Нажмите кнопку «Create».
Создание таблицы
После создания базы данных вам потребуется создать в ней таблицы для хранения данных. Вот как это сделать:
Выберите базу данных из панели навигации, в которой вы хотите создать таблицу.
В рабочей области вы увидите раздел «Create Table», где необходимо ввести имя таблицы.
Укажите необходимое количество столбцов и нажмите «Go».
На следующей странице вы можете задать имя, тип, длину для каждого столбца и другие атрибуты, такие как первичный ключ или уникальность.
После настройки столбцов нажмите кнопку «Save», чтобы создать таблицу.
Вставка данных в таблицы
После создания таблицы можно вставить данные, используя следующие шаги:
Выберите таблицу, в которую вы хотите добавить данные, из панели навигации.
Нажмите на вкладку «Insert» в рабочей области.
Заполните поля колонок, в которые вы хотите ввести данные.
После заполнения всех полей нажмите кнопку «Go», чтобы вставить данные в таблицу.
Выполнение SQL-запросов
PHPMyAdmin позволяет выполнять пользовательские SQL-запросы для сложных взаимодействий с базой данных:
Нажмите на вкладку «SQL» в рабочей области PHPMyAdmin.
Введите ваш SQL-запрос в текстовое поле SQL Query.
Нажмите кнопку «Go», чтобы выполнить запрос. Если будут обнаружены ошибки, PHPMyAdmin выделит их, чтобы помочь вам в устранении неполадок.
Экспорт базы данных
Экспорт базы данных — это полезная функция, особенно для резервного копирования и миграции:
В PHPMyAdmin нажмите на базу данных, которую хотите экспортировать, в панели навигации.
Нажмите на вкладку «Export» в рабочей области.
Выберите метод экспорта: метод «Quick» рекомендуется для большинства пользователей.
Выберите формат, в котором хотите экспортировать базу данных, например SQL.
Нажмите кнопку «Go», и база данных будет загружена на ваш локальный компьютер.
Импорт базы данных
Подобно экспорту, можно также импортировать базу данных на ваш локальный сервер:
Нажмите на вкладку «Import» в рабочей области.
Используйте кнопку «Choose File», чтобы выбрать файл базы данных, который вы хотите импортировать.
Выберите формат файла для импорта, обычно это SQL-файл.
Нажмите кнопку «Go», чтобы начать процесс импорта.
Управление пользователями
Управление пользователями и разрешениями — это критически важный аспект безопасности базы данных:
В PHPMyAdmin нажмите на вкладку «Users» в рабочей области.
Вы увидите список существующих пользователей. Вы можете редактировать или удалять пользователей, либо нажать «Add user account», чтобы создать нового пользователя.
Заполните сведения о пользователе, включая имя пользователя, хост, пароль и специфические для базы данных разрешения.
Предоставьте пользователям соответствующие права, чтобы управлять уровнем их доступа.
Резервное копирование и восстановление
Резервное копирование базы данных — это важная задача для защиты данных, и PHPMyAdmin делает ее простой:
Как указано ранее, вы можете использовать функциональность экспорта для резервного копирования данных. Храните эти файлы в безопасности, так как они будут нужны для восстановления данных.
Восстанавливайте резервные копии, используя функцию Import для загрузки и выполнения сохраненных SQL-файлов.
Заключение
PHPMyAdmin в сочетании с XAMPP предлагает очень функциональный, но при этом удобный интерфейс для управления базой данных. От создания и изменения баз данных и таблиц до выполнения SQL-запросов и управления пользователями, PHPMyAdmin предоставляет всю необходимую функциональность для эффективного администрирования баз данных. Используя это подробное руководство, вы должны иметь твердое понимание того, как эффективно использовать PHPMyAdmin для ваших нужд управления базами данных.
Если вы найдете что-то неправильное в содержании статьи, вы можете